The Decathlon Active Desk worked smoothly in testing and takes up very little space. It also earns points for not needing a power outlet. That said, getting your desk chair, computer and the trainer positioned correctly takes a bit of fiddling. You can’t just drop it on the floor and start pedaling.
Pros
- + requires little space
- + works without electricity
- + adjustable intensity
Cons
- - awkward to position
- - not silent in operation

The Quechua Arpenaz 0˚ Ultim Comfort from Decathlon is designed for campers who prize bed-like comfort even when nights turn chilly. This cosy sleeping bag features a soft cotton lining that feels warm, breathable and familiar against the skin, making it particularly appealing for relaxed autumnal car camping where comfort is as important as insulation performance.
Pros
- Comfortable and warm
- Good leg room
- Soft cotton lining
- Hood and neck warmers
- Good price
Cons
- Heavy material
- Far too bulky for backpacking
